The Transactions & M&A Due Diligence Senior Consultant should lead ESG, EHS and sustainable finance due diligence assignments across mergers, acquisitions, divestments, refinancing and capital market transactions. The role supports investors, corporates, lenders and financial institutions by identifying value-relevant ESG & EHS risks and opportunities, assessing regulatory and climate exposure, and translating sustainability insights into transaction-ready decision-making.
Key Responsibilities
- Lead ESG/EHS due diligence for acquisitions, divestments and financing operations.
- Define scope and workplans aligned with transaction timelines and investor requirements.
- Coordinate with financial, legal, technical and commercial due diligence teams.
- Identify ESG/EHS risks and opportunities with direct relevance to value, pricing and risk allocation.
- Integrate ESG/EHS findings into deal structuring, financing conditions and contractual protections.
- Support green, social and sustainability-linked finance transactions.
- Assess alignment with EU Taxonomy, SFDR and investor or lender ESG/EHS criteria.
- Act as senior ESG/EHS due diligence lead for investors and corporate clients.
- Support business development and transaction pitches.
- Monitor regulatory and market trends affecting ESG/EHS expectations in transactions.
- Maintain technical, financial and contractual control of due diligence engagements.
- Ensure delivery of decision-oriented, time-critical outputs under transaction pressure.
- Lead and develop ESG/EHS due diligence teams.
- Ensure consistency of methodologies and knowledge.
